  • Five years ago, My Arcade released the Namco Museum Mini Player. It was a 10” cabinet with a vertical aspect ratio screen, loaded with real arcade versions of a number of classics like Pac-Man, Dig Dug, & Galaga. It was released right alongside the first wave of Micro Players that included NES ports of the same games. And yet, inexplicably, those took off like a rocket, while this product faded into the background. What happened to the Mini Player? Why did simpler products take off while this little beauty became a footnote in the story of arcade toys? Let's try to figure it out in this video.

    The problem with the small screen for Rolling Thunder is not really their fault. It's just a geometry issue of how big of a rectangle of the correct proportion can you fit in a screen that is vertically oriented.* They could have used a horizontally oriented screen but then the vertical games would have the same issue in the other direction. I suppose they could have used a more square-ish 4:3 screen that would lend itself better to being adapted for both horizontal and vertical games, but probably would have cost them more money. The vertical screen, I imagine, was just one that was already available cheaply and most of the games on the list are vertically oriented so that's what happened.

    I have this machine. It's essentially a Coleco tabletop game with the real arcade games on it, and for me, that's just good enough. However, you're not wrong about the flaws. The hardware is kludged together with an old tablet processor and a PSP screen, and this becomes especially evident if you hack it. I've thrown about three hundred ROMs at this thing, and maybe half of those functioned well enough to keep them on the system. CPS1 and CPS2 are straight out, and Neo-Geo is a little iffy. If you install 8-bit games and use a really old version of MAME, those run well enough.
    What's maddening is that the processor used has a micro USB connector on the board, but it doesn't do anything, because MyArcade's firmware isn't designed for it and nobody's written a custom firmware for this fairly obscure system. So you're stuck with the crappy MyArcade joystick, unless you're willing to do a lot of work replacing it. I wound up grinding down the red nub and gluing a wooden bead on the top, and setting metal washers on the bottom, to force some degree of responsiveness from what is a very unresponsive controller. Like the rest of the Namco Museum mini arcade, it's just good enough for a quick, dirty fix, but these old arcade games really deserve microswitches, and you won't get them unless you're willing to tear the machine apart and install them yourself.
